What is nightclub singers?

Nightclub singers are professional entertainers who perform in nightclubs and music venues. They typically perform a mix of popular songs, jazz, blues, and other styles of music.

The job of a nightclub singer is to engage and entertain the audience, creating a high-energy atmosphere and encouraging guests to sing and dance along. They may perform solo or with a band, and often interact with the crowd, taking requests and interacting with guests.

To become a nightclub singer, one typically needs vocal and musical talent, strong stage presence, and the ability to connect with an audience. Many nightclub singers have formal training in music or theater, while others may have gained experience through performing in local productions or at open mic nights.

Nightclub singing can be a challenging and competitive field, with many performers vying for limited opportunities at popular venues. However, with hard work and dedication, talented singers can achieve success and build a loyal fan base.
